Beauty & the Beast might be considered a timeless love story, but in the hands of DuffleBag Theatre this lovely tale goes topsy-turvy in an interactive feat of comedy! This sidesplitting adaptation stars members of the audience as DuffleBag sets the kooky scene. The results are spontaneous, unique, engaging, always hilarious and fun for the whole family!
About DuffleBag Theatre
The “Nearly World Famous” DuffleBag Theatre has been performing since 1992 starting at the London International Children’s Festival, in London, Ontario, Canada. Now based in Toronto, DuffleBag performs over 600 shows a year, across Canada, the U.S., and internationally. Marcus Lundgren is the Artistic Director, and Rod Keith is the General Manager.
There are 15 different shows in the company’s current repertoire, from fairy tales and classic stories, to Shakespeare adaptations and holiday-themed shows. All are performed with the same sense of fun, innovation, and participation that audiences (nearly) the world over have come to expect!
